What kind of animals lay eggs? Where do they lay them, and how do they look after them?
Meet some of Australia's incredible egg-laying animals. Starting at the sea, Hatch takes us on a journey inland and underground, to the treetops high above, and back down to a waterhole, till finally we reach the sea once more.

With detailed and vibrant illustrations, Hatch provides a glimpse of these amazing egg-laying creatures, the unique habitats in which they live and how they look after their young.

Reading level varies from child to child, but we recommend this book for ages 5 to 9.

Heidi Cooper Smith has always held a love and fascination for animals, particularly those that could be found in her own backyard. Growing up in the bush on a diet of David Attenborough documentaries, she wants to help foster this appreciation in the next generation.
